Module: Terrafying::Locks

Defined in:
lib/terrafying/lock.rb

Defined Under Namespace

Classes: NoOpLock

Class Method Summary collapse

Class Method Details

.dynamodb(scope) ⇒ Object



23
24
25
# File 'lib/terrafying/lock.rb', line 23

def self.dynamodb(scope)
  Terrafying::DynamoDb::NamedLock.new(Terrafying::DynamoDb.config.lock_table, scope)
end

.noopObject



19
20
21
# File 'lib/terrafying/lock.rb', line 19

def self.noop
  NoOpLock.new
end